James McAvoy: Sexy and humble

Wnxclusivesmall_5 People may have hot photos of the Sexiest Men alive, but USA WEEKEND has the inside scoop on a few of them. Our TV editor, Michele Hatty, interviewed Patrick Dempsey, and Who's News reporter Jon Tollestrup recently talked to James McAvoy (who you can see below in the trailer for his upcoming movie, Wanted). Michele will dish on McDreamy later today, and here's what Jon has to say about talking to the sexy Scotsman:

"I have to say, with a staunch record of heterosexuality, that I'm not at all surprised James made the cut of this year's sexiest men. I mean, apart from being good-looking, he’s just simply a classy, humble guy. Plus, the Scottish accent is pretty cool. When it came time to do the interview, I tried calling his number in London several  times, but couldn’t get anything but a random recording of an Indian woman saying I had insufficient funds for this call. I frantically dialed the telephone company to try and get the call through, but it took nearly an hour before things were solved. But James was as polite and gracious as if I had called on time. This might not seem like a big deal, but trust me, most regular people, let alone a celebrity, wouldn’t have been so patient and accommodating. For a celebrity to wait an hour for a small-time writer to call can be like a normal person waiting 10 hours for the pizza delivery boy to show up."
